KRIS DAVIS TRIO
Based in New York, Canadian pianist and composer Kris Davis has established herself as a key figure in contemporary jazz, driven by her singular talent and the audacious productions of her Pyroclastic Records label. Winner of a Grammy Award in 2023 and named “Pianist of the Year” in 2025 by DownBeat magazine, she has collected a host of distinctions. Her influences, from Messiaen to Charlie Parker, nourish a music that is demanding but always luminous. In 2024, backed by two first-rate companions - drummer Johnathan Blake and bassist Robert Hurst - she signed Run the Gauntlet, a trio album paying vibrant tribute to six great pianists, including Geri Allen and Carla Bley. This concert naturally resonates with the creation of the Orchestre national de jazz With Carla, directed by Sylvaine Hélary, who had already invited Kris Davis for her Spring Roll project.
ORCHESTRE NATIONAL DE JAZZ
WITH CARLA
For her first program as artistic director of the ONJ, flutist and composer Sylvaine Hélary pays tribute to Carla Bley, an unclassifiable figure in jazz who died in October 2023. Pianist, composer, magnificent arranger and bandleader, but also rebellious, shy, wild, adventurous and fiercely independent, the American artist left behind a treasure trove of scores and recordings. To revisit Carla Bley's compositions, Sylvaine Hélary and the inventive saxophonist Rémi Sciuto have immersed themselves in her protean universe and offer a program that navigates between orchestral frescoes and more chamber-like moments, gentle songs and unbridled rhythms, highlighting Carla Bley's distinctive sound palette, captivating rhythms, humor and bold harmonies.
